What do you think of when someone says, “Surrender?” To surrender brings ideas of giving in, submitting or even quitting. Sometimes, to surrender can be a good thing. The most impactful, and maybe the most important decision you make, is when we surrender to the will of God the Father.
Let’s look at Moses. We see in Exodus 3, Moses, called by God, was charged with leading the release of Israelites from Pharaoh. “And now the cry of the Israelites has reached me, and I have seen the way the Egyptians are oppressing them. So now, go. I am sending you to Pharaoh to bring my people the Israelites out of Egypt.” (v. 9-10). Moses felt unprepared and ill equipped to take on such a responsibility. No matter what God said or the signs and miracles He showed Moses, he was still hesitant. “But Moses said, “Pardon your servant, Lord. Please send someone else.”(v.13)
Are we like this at times? Do we feel God calling us to a task where we hesitate? A new opportunity that we don’t feel confident or capable of. We have all been there. I challenge you to go into prayer about any questions or decisions. Oswald Chambers stated, “There is only thing God wants of us, and that is our unconditional surrender.” When we Focus on Jesus, we can submit to His will with confidence. He will always be with us!
